What is 83/96 as a percentage? It works out to 86.46% when rounded to two decimal places. This fraction is just a little bit less than a whole, so its percentage is close to 100 % but not quite there.
The fraction 83/96 can be thought of as 83 parts out of a total of 96 equal parts. When you compare it to a full set (100 %), you see it represents a solid majority—over 80 % of the whole. That’s why the percentage is in the mid‑80s.
In everyday terms, if you had 96 items and you owned 83 of them, you’d own about 86.46% of the total. This kind of conversion is useful for quickly understanding proportions in reports, grades, or simple sharing scenarios.
